Looks like someone tried to break in
and now my front passenger door sticks out a little (as seen in picture). Is there any way to fix this besides a new door? Pretty pissed because I park on a Navy base...

Depending on if your insurance will cover or not here is what I have done in the past to a door that stuck out like yours. If insurance will cover do nothing if they don't roll the window down and open the door, either have someone hold the door by the main part of the door while you pull on the top of the window frame near the rear edge. Do this just hard enough to make it flex a little towards the car. Now close the door and see how it looks. If need be do it again till you get it where you want it. A little at a time only you don't want to make it worse. I've done this with truck doors that leaked air and water by sitting on the seat with my feet on the door and pulling the top of the window frame till you get it right and truck doors are a lot stronger than the IS doors.

+1 Roll down the window, have someone hold the lower part of the door. Push on top to bend it back into position. Bend it a little and close the door to check, after every bend till you get it to where it needs to sit.
As for the key marks you can hide it with touch up paint. If the scratches are deep you can grab 320-600 grit sand paper to smooth out before applying the touch up.
